Left and Right Bumpers on Xbox One Controller Have Stopped Working
I use the bumpers for shift gears up and down (Sequential) and hold for left and right turn signals.

Did work fine and then just stopped. All the other button/triggers work fine as before, just not the bumpers.

Have tried more than one controller, and all work fine on other games, do have xinput enabled as disabling this wrecks everything else including desktop functionality.

In-game settings are set to keyboard only (as before when they worked fine).

Have tried re-binding the bumpers via the Steam UI with no success and also via the in-game settings where neither the bumpers or buttons register (presumably due to the xinput being enabled).

Not sure as to what to try next to resolve this issue.

Ok, so ...

Prolly took the longer route around but have now fixed this

Tried a good few variations and as posted above, was unable to select Xinput and add a second controller (@ Xbox for Windows) without deselecting the Xbox controller in the Steam Controller settings (although did try this solution which did work to some degree), as previously posted this wrecks so many other game settings for me and renders the controller useless on desktop.

Thanks for the in-put and suggestion though.

In a nut shell, in the end I ended up junking my tried and trusted Xbox One Steam input settings. Re-imported the SCS Official template and then with some long winded measures edited it back to my original bindings and that has solved this issue for me.
